Why do fence posts in Hampton Borough Center need footings below 42 inches?
The local 42-inch frost line depth is a structural requirement. Footings set above this depth are subject to frost heave, which will lift and crack posts. All Hampton installations must comply with IRC frost-protection standards to prevent failure.
What are my legal duties before replacing a shared fence in Hampton, NJ?
Under New Jersey's partition fence law (N.J.S.A. 4:20-4), you must provide written notice to the adjoining property owner before constructing or replacing a shared boundary fence. As of 2026, this formal notification is a prerequisite for any shared fence project.

What is required before digging fence post holes in Hampton?
You must contact New Jersey 811 for a full utility locate at least three business days before excavation. Striking a line in a dense area like Hampton Borough Center carries major repair costs and liability. A professional contractor typically manages this and the associated borough permit paperwork.
How does the 115 MPH V-ult wind rating affect a fence's design?
The 115 MPH ultimate design wind speed dictates structural engineering. Post spacing must be reduced and concrete footing size increased to resist overturning. All hardware, including post brackets, must be rated for this wind load to survive peak storm season gusts common to the region.
How do Hampton's soil and termite risks affect material choice?
Hampton's moderate soil corrosivity index and moderate termite risk demand material compatibility. Use pressure-treated wood rated for ground contact or corrosion-resistant metals like aluminum. All fasteners must be hot-dip galvanized or stainless steel to prevent rust streaks and premature failure.
